September 23-29, 2007
Geelong Forum, Victoria, Australia
Joan Schulze: Master Class
Collage: The Fan—An Approach to Design.
Description—
Japanese, French and Chinese artists created fans both useful and decorative and inspired artists such as Van Gogh, Matisse and many others. They often used the fan shape or theme in their art making. The possibilites are endless. We will use many textile techniques including glue transfer, beginning and advanced photocopy processes, monoprinting, wrapping and some 3-D construction.
